    Health Benefits of Drinking Turmeric Milk at Night

    In this monsoon season, people are very much vulnerable to innocent diseases. Especially, many people are affected by the problem of cold and cough. In such a situation, to strengthen your immune system, drink milk every night before going to bed. If you add a pinch of turmeric to milk and drink it, then your health will benefit manifold. Actually turmeric is a spice which is considered to be full of Ayurvedic properties. While antiseptic and anti-biotic properties are found in turmeric, calcium is found in large quantities in milk. When both of these are mixed and consumed together, it has many health benefits.

    Benefits of drinking turmeric milk at night

    1. Immunity will be strengthened

    Consuming turmeric milk before sleeping at night can help in strengthening immunity. Curcumin present in turmeric milk works as an immunomodulatory agent, which protects the body from many diseases can help prevent diseases and increase immunity.

    2. Protection from infection

    The incidence of infections rises markedly during the cold season. Turmeric milk, known for its antimicrobial properties, is regarded as an effective means to combat bacterial infections. To mitigate the risk of infection, it is advisable to include turmeric milk into your diet.

    3. Cold and cough away

    Cold and cough are a common problem in the monsoon season. To get rid of the problem of cold and cough, you can add turmeric to lukewarm milk and drink it at night. This can help in keeping the body warm from inside.

    How to prepare special turmeric milk?

    1. Heat a glass of milk.
    2. When the milk starts boiling, add a pinch of turmeric to it.
    3. After this, filter it in a cup.
    4. Now add jaggery or sugar to it for taste.
    5. Drink it lukewarm before sleeping.
    6. If you have diabetes, joint pain or heart related problems, then add a pinch of nutmeg to it.
